You can do amplitude modulation with your phase-only SLM. For amplitude modulation you need to rotate the incident polarization by 45º and use an analyzer after the SLM.

As our SLMs are optimized for phase modulation at first, the contrast might not be as good as for our amplitude devices. Also dependent on the used SLM the output might get slightly “blurry” due to the higher thickness of the LC layer.

As the phase SLMs are typically calibrated for a linear phase response, the calibration needs to be adjusted for optimal amplitude contrast. Please contact us if you need support on this!
